VPN加密技术,原理、应用与未来发展

在当今数字化时代,网络安全和数据隐私已成为全球关注的焦点,虚拟专用网络(VPN)作为一种广泛使用的网络安全工具,通过加密技术为用户提供了安全的数据传输通道,本文将深入探讨VPN加密技术的原理、应用场景、常见加密算法以及未来发展趋势,帮助读者全面理解VPN如何保障数据安全。


VPN加密技术的基本原理

VPN的核心功能是通过加密技术将用户的网络流量进行保护,使其在公共互联网上传输时免受窃听或篡改,加密技术的基本原理可以概括为以下几个步骤:

  1. 数据封装:VPN将用户的原始数据(如网页请求、文件传输等)封装在一个加密的数据包中,使其在传输过程中无法被第三方直接读取。
  2. 加密算法:VPN使用特定的加密算法(如AES、RSA等)对数据进行加密,只有拥有解密密钥的接收方才能还原原始数据。
  3. 隧道协议:VPN通过隧道协议(如OpenVPN、IPSec、WireGuard等)建立一条安全的通信通道,确保数据在传输过程中不被拦截或篡改。

VPN加密的主要算法

VPN的加密强度直接取决于所使用的加密算法,以下是几种常见的VPN加密算法:

  1. 对称加密算法

    • AES(高级加密标准):目前最常用的对称加密算法,支持128位、192位和256位密钥长度,AES-256被广泛认为是军事级别的加密标准。
    • ChaCha20:一种轻量级的对称加密算法,适用于移动设备,性能优于AES。
  2. 非对称加密算法

    • RSA:基于大数分解的数学难题,通常用于密钥交换和身份验证,RSA-2048或RSA-4096是常见的安全标准。
    • ECDSA(椭圆曲线数字签名算法):比RSA更高效,能够在更短的密钥长度下提供相同的安全性。
  3. 哈希函数

    • SHA-256:用于数据完整性验证,确保数据在传输过程中未被篡改。

VPN加密的应用场景

VPN加密技术在多个领域发挥着重要作用:

  1. 企业远程办公

    企业员工通过VPN安全访问公司内部资源(如数据库、文件服务器),防止敏感数据泄露。

  2. 个人隐私保护

    用户通过VPN隐藏真实IP地址,避免网络跟踪或地理位置限制(如访问流媒体内容)。

  3. 政府与军事通信

    政府和军事机构使用高强度加密的VPN传输机密信息,确保通信安全。

  4. 规避审查与封锁

    在互联网审查严格的国家,VPN帮助用户绕过防火墙,访问被屏蔽的网站和服务。


VPN加密的挑战与局限性

尽管VPN加密技术提供了强大的安全保障,但仍存在一些挑战:

  1. 性能开销

    加密和解密过程会消耗计算资源,可能导致网络延迟或带宽下降。

  2. 密钥管理

    密钥的生成、存储和分发是加密系统的薄弱环节,一旦密钥泄露,整个系统安全性将受到威胁。

  3. 协议漏洞

    某些VPN协议(如PPTP)已被证明存在安全漏洞,不适合高安全性需求。

  4. 法律与监管

    部分国家对VPN的使用有严格限制,甚至禁止未经批准的加密通信。


VPN加密的未来发展趋势

随着技术的进步和网络安全威胁的演变,VPN加密技术也在不断发展:

  1. 后量子加密

    量子计算机的出现可能威胁现有加密算法(如RSA),未来的VPN将采用抗量子计算的加密算法(如基于格的加密)。

  2. 零信任架构

    VPN将与零信任安全模型结合,通过持续身份验证和动态访问控制提升安全性。

  3. WireGuard的普及

    WireGuard是一种新型VPN协议,以高性能和简洁的代码设计成为未来VPN的主流选择。

  4. AI驱动的威胁检测

    人工智能将被用于实时监测VPN流量,识别并阻止潜在的网络攻击。


VPN加密技术是网络安全的重要组成部分,它通过强大的加密算法和隧道协议为用户提供了安全、私密的网络通信环境,尽管面临性能、密钥管理和法律监管等挑战,但随着后量子加密、零信任架构等新技术的发展,VPN将继续在保护数据隐私和网络安全中发挥关键作用,对于普通用户和企业来说,选择可靠的VPN服务并了解其加密原理,是确保网络安全的第一步。

VPN加密技术,原理、应用与未来发展

扫码下载闪连翻墙软件

扫码下载闪连翻墙软件

400-33665566
扫码下载闪连翻墙软件

扫码下载闪连翻墙软件